    Getting a lash lift is a popular cosmetic procedure that enhances the appearance of your natural eyelashes. This treatment involves perming the lashes to curl upwards, giving them a longer and more voluminous look without the need for mascara or extensions. The process typically lasts around 60-90 minutes and can provide results that last between 6-8 weeks, depending on individual lash growth cycles.

    One of the primary benefits of a lash lift is its low maintenance. Unlike eyelash extensions, which require regular touch-ups and careful maintenance, a lash lift allows you to enjoy fuller, more defined lashes without the daily hassle of applying mascara. Additionally, the procedure is generally safe for most people, with minimal risk of irritation or allergic reactions, provided it is performed by a trained professional.

    However, it's important to consider that individual results may vary. Some people may find that their lashes appear more dramatic and attractive, while others might not notice a significant difference. The cost of a lash lift can also be a factor, as it typically ranges from $50 to $150, depending on the location and the salon.

    In summary, getting a lash lift can be worth it if you're looking for a low-maintenance way to enhance your eyelashes. It offers a natural, long-lasting solution that can save you time and effort in your daily beauty routine. However, it's essential to consult with a professional to ensure the procedure is suitable for your specific needs and to understand the potential outcomes.

    Understanding the Lash Lift Procedure

    A lash lift is a semi-permanent cosmetic treatment designed to enhance the appearance of your natural eyelashes. It involves curling your lashes upwards and sometimes tinting them to give a fuller, more defined look. This procedure is often compared to a perm for your lashes, as it alters the structure of the lashes to maintain a curled appearance for several weeks.

    Benefits of a Lash Lift

    One of the primary advantages of a lash lift is the time it saves in your daily beauty routine. For those who struggle with mascara clumps or find lash extensions too high-maintenance, a lash lift offers a low-effort solution. The results are subtle yet effective, providing a natural-looking enhancement that doesn't require daily application or removal. Additionally, a lash lift is suitable for most lash types, including straight, thin, or sparse lashes, making it a versatile option for many individuals.

    Is It Worth the Investment?

    Deciding whether a lash lift is worth it depends on your personal preferences and lifestyle. If you value convenience and a natural look, a lash lift can be a worthwhile investment. It eliminates the need for daily mascara application and the hassle of dealing with lash extensions, which can be time-consuming and costly to maintain. Moreover, the semi-permanent nature of the treatment means you won't need frequent touch-ups, making it a cost-effective option in the long run.

    Potential Drawbacks

    While a lash lift offers many benefits, it's essential to consider potential drawbacks. Some individuals may experience mild irritation or sensitivity during or after the procedure. It's crucial to consult with a professional to ensure you are a suitable candidate and to minimize any risks. Additionally, the results are not permanent, and you will need to repeat the treatment every few weeks to maintain the lifted look.

    Conclusion

    In summary, a lash lift can be a game-changer for those looking to simplify their morning routine and achieve a natural, enhanced lash appearance. Its convenience, versatility, and cost-effectiveness make it a compelling option for many. However, it's important to weigh the potential drawbacks and consult with a professional to determine if a lash lift is the right choice for you. Ultimately, the decision should align with your personal beauty goals and lifestyle.

    Understanding the Benefits of a Lash Lift

    A lash lift is a semi-permanent cosmetic procedure that enhances the appearance of your natural lashes. It involves curling your lashes upwards and adding a tint to make them appear darker and more voluminous. This treatment is often compared to a perm for your lashes, but it is gentler and more subtle.

    Enhanced Natural Beauty

    One of the primary advantages of a lash lift is that it enhances your natural beauty without the need for extensions or mascara. The procedure lifts and curls your lashes, giving them a more open and awake appearance. This can be particularly beneficial for those who have straight lashes that do not hold a curl well with traditional mascara.

    Long-Lasting Results

    Unlike mascara, which needs to be applied daily and can smudge or run, a lash lift provides long-lasting results. The effects of a lash lift can last anywhere from 6 to 8 weeks, depending on your lash growth cycle. This makes it a convenient option for those who want to maintain a consistent look without daily maintenance.

    Gentle on Lashes

    A lash lift is a gentle procedure that does not involve the use of adhesives or heavy products that can damage your lashes. Unlike lash extensions, which can cause strain and breakage, a lash lift simply enhances what you already have. This makes it a safer and more sustainable option for long-term lash health.

    Customizable for Individual Needs

    Every person's lashes are unique, and a lash lift can be customized to suit individual needs. Whether you want a subtle lift or a more dramatic effect, the procedure can be tailored to achieve the desired look. This flexibility ensures that you get a result that complements your natural features and personal style.

    Conclusion

    In summary, a lash lift is a worthwhile investment for those looking to enhance their natural lashes in a subtle yet effective way. It offers long-lasting results, is gentle on lashes, and can be customized to meet individual preferences. If you're considering a lash lift, it's advisable to consult with a professional to ensure the best possible outcome for your unique lash needs.

    Understanding the Benefits of a Lash Lift

    A lash lift is a semi-permanent cosmetic procedure that enhances the appearance of your natural eyelashes. It involves curling your lashes upwards and adding a tint to make them appear darker and more voluminous. This treatment is often compared to eyelash extensions but offers a more natural look and requires less maintenance.

    The Procedure Explained

    During a lash lift, a silicone rod is placed along your lash line to create the desired curl. Your lashes are then coated with a lifting solution, which is left on for a specific amount of time to achieve the curl. Afterward, a setting solution is applied to stabilize the curl and a tint is added if desired. The entire process typically takes about 60-90 minutes and results can last between 6-8 weeks.

    Advantages of a Lash Lift

    1. Natural Appearance: Unlike eyelash extensions, a lash lift enhances your natural lashes, providing a more subtle and natural look.
    2. Low Maintenance: Once the procedure is done, there is no need for daily maintenance like with mascara or eyelash extensions.
    3. Time-Saving: With a lash lift, you can skip the daily routine of applying and removing mascara, saving you valuable time.
    4. Customizable: The procedure can be tailored to your specific lash type and desired look, whether you prefer a slight curl or a more dramatic lift.

    Considerations Before Getting a Lash Lift

    While a lash lift offers many benefits, it's important to consider a few factors before undergoing the procedure. First, ensure you visit a licensed professional to minimize the risk of damage to your lashes. Second, be aware that individuals with very short or sparse lashes may not achieve the same dramatic results as those with longer, fuller lashes. Lastly, like any cosmetic procedure, there is a slight risk of irritation or allergic reaction, so it's advisable to do a patch test before the full treatment.

    Conclusion

    In summary, a lash lift can be a worthwhile investment for those looking to enhance their natural lashes with a low-maintenance, natural-looking solution. By understanding the procedure and its benefits, you can make an informed decision that aligns with your beauty goals. Always consult with a professional to ensure the best results and to address any concerns you may have.
